Discohelicidae

Discohelicidae is an extinct family of sea snails with planispiral shells, marine gastropod mollusks in the clade Vetigastropoda.

Time the record covers

At least 238 million years on record.

The record covers at least 241.464 Mya to 2.58 Mya. No occurrence read is dated outside 247 Mya to 774 ka.

232 occurrences of Discohelicidae on record, most of them in the Early Jurassic. Bar height is expected occurrences, not a count: each fossil is spread across the span it is dated to, so a tall narrow bar means tight dating and a low wide one means loose.
